Title: Generate playlist automatically when ripping
Post by: nazgulord on 2005-12-04 03:08:12
Hey guys,

Is there any way to make foobar create a playlist of the tracks it rips from a cd automatically when it is ripping?

For example, 12 tracks get ripped from the cd, and a playlist is created of those 12 tracks during ripping, and the playlist is saved in the folder with the ripped tracks.

I'm using version 0.8.3, and I'd greatly appreciate any info on this.

Okay, it goes something like this:

I usually rip 2 or 3 cds at once, so once they're ripped I add the files to the database. Then using the album list panel plugin, I double-click on the new album entries to create playlists with the title as the album (changed the config of album list panel so the double-click action is "send to new playlist"). Then it's a simple matter of right-clicking on any of the playlist tabs, and choosing save all playlists. I just choose my folder, and I'm done.

This works for 1 album as well. Just choose Save Playlist after bringing up the playlist from the album list panel.

It's still a bit of manual work, and it would be nice if someone found a way to automatically make a playlist...something like CDEx does...
